Zebra DS457 + Perle Serial Server DS1 or Devolinx STE-501C or STE-502C

Set up the Ethernet to serial Perle DS1 device

Log in to the web configuration page of the device

http://192.168.100.211 -> Go to a web page and enter the ip address of the device

Login. The default user is admin and the default password is superuser


Set the static ip address

Perle IP Address


Set the device to TCP Sockets mode. Set the port for it to listen on and allow multiple connections.

Perle TCP Sockets


Set the serial port settings. These are the settings that work with the Zebra fixed mount DS457 scanner. The Zebra scanner is a half duplex device.

Setup the Ethernet to serial Devolinx device

Run the Monitor app on a Windows machine to configure a new device. The app is found on the CD that comes with the device.

Devolinx Monitor app


Select the device from the list and click Config

Devolinx Monitor app Config dialog

Enter the IP address and gateway you want to use. It should be on the same network as the rest of the LinkPOS devices (iPads, printers, etc)

Browse to the device web configuration page in a browser on the same network:

Devolinx web configuration

On the Networking page you can configure the device the same way the Monitor app does:

Devolinx TCP configuration page

On the COM pages you can configure each port. Each port should be set up as a TCP Server and should listen on separate ports. This device is set up to listen on port 4660:

Devolinx COM configuration

The default settings for the serial device are Baud Rate 9600, 8 bits, no parity, 1 stop bit. This works for the Zebra fixed mount DS 457 scanner and the POSX pole display.
